Union Commerce Minister Piyush Goyal
has said that the
India-UK free trade agreement is massive win for farmers ensuring duty-free exports on nearly 95 per cent of agricultural products, while fisherfolk gain from zero duty on 99 per cent of marine exports, boosting their incomes.

Duty-free access for about 99 per cent of Indian exports unlocks nearly $23 billion in opportunities for labour-intensive sectors, marking a new era for inclusive and gender-equitable growth.

Adding that Artisans, weavers, and daily-wage labourers employed in several MSMEs across textiles, leather, footwear, gems and jewellery, toys, and marine products will step into a new phase of prosperity. From village looms to tech labs, this FTA marks a historic leap for women through improved access to finance and deeper integration into global value chains.
He continued that the deal will also have a transformative impact on manufacturing-intensive sectors like engineering goods, electronics, pharma, chemicals, food processing, and plastics. This agreement will also provide Indian consumers high quality goods at competitive prices.-India’s talent in IT, services, and education will gain from easier access to the UK’s high-value markets. The three-year exemption from social security contributions in UK as part of the Double Contribution Convention is a significant breakthrough for Indian workers and their employers. He further went in to say that Chefs, yoga instructors, musicians and business visitors will benefit, advancing our vision to be a global talent hub.
